On Fri, 04 Apr 2025 15:40:46 +0200, Marc Haber wrote: > I am an old fart myself, and I refrain from using killall since it does > different things on Solaris than on Linux. My use of killall is very limited. On Ubuntu Brave is a snap and updating a running process is beyond snap's capabilities. Brave spawns a lot of processes and 'killall brave' gets rid of them with the advantage that it will restore your tabs on restart.
